Plainfield, IL Rental Market Overview

The average rent in Plainfield, IL is $1,856 per month. For comparison, the national average rent price in the US is currently $1,661/month, which means Plainfield rent prices are 12% higher than the national average.

  • Studio apartments in Plainfield average $1,708 per month.
  • One-bedroom apartments in Plainfield average $1,856 per month.
  • Two-bedroom apartments in Plainfield average $2,185 per month.
  • Three-bedroom apartments in Plainfield average $2,811 or more per month.

How much has average rent changed in Plainfield, IL?

In the past year, rent has decreased by 0.8%, which averages out to $13 less per month.

What salary do I need to live comfortably in Plainfield, IL?

Because the average rent in Plainfield is $1,856, you’ll want to make about $6,186 per month or $74,232 per year. The general guideline is to pay no more than 30 percent of your monthly income on rent. However, you’ll want to consider additional factors, such as your monthly bills and other expenses.
